Ohio Court Allows Say-on-Pay Case to Proceed In a September 20, 2011 Opinion, Judge Timothy Black of the Southern District of Ohio ruled that a lawsuit brought against senior executives and directors of Cincinnati Bell, Inc. alleging a breach of fiduciary duty regarding compensation would be allowed to proceed. Consumers should stop using recalled products immediately unless otherwise instructed: Fall Hazard Prompts NHTSA, CPSC and Dorel Juvenile Group to Announce Recall of Infant Car Seat/Carriers Name of product: Dorel Infant Car Seat/Carriers Units: About 447,000 Manufacturer: Dorel Juvenile Group Inc., of Columbus, Ind.
